Overall, what do you expect for such a cheap price? You're going to get a chinese curtain rod that may or may not hold as much weight as you expect. Some people seem to expect to use this as monkey bar (my brother in law) and then when it falls off they curse it!Well to get this to really stick there are a few things you can do.1. Make sure everything is SUPER dry. Put this in place exactly where you want it, and run a bead of silicone around the edge and this will keep water from getting in between the rubber pad and the wall and this ups the strength immensely. I did this and it hasn't moved a single inch.2. If you find you can't make it stick even then you have one of two choices, first is Liquid Nails or the like and literally construction adhesive it right in place which can hold so much weight the bar will just collapse before it let's go from the wall, or worse, you'll tear out a tile or a piece of the wall before it gives way.3. Your other option is to send a screw through it. Yep, exactly why you bought a No Drill version is straight out the window but let me tell ya, it works. Slather the screw in silicone so that no water can find it's way through the hole and this will be rock solid.Overall it's cheap and works as I expected and would recommend to people who understand what they are getting.
